Based on the illustration, what happens to most of the mass gained by the plant cell through photosynthesis? A) The mass is retu

rned to the soil. B) The reactants of photosynthesis are used as the reactants of respiration. C) The products of photosynthesis are shuttled back into the photosynthesis reaction as reactants. D) The mass produced by the photosynthesis reaction is used by the plant to fuel respiration and is turned into carbon dioxide, water, and energy.

<h3><u>Answer;</u></h3>

<em>D) The mass produced by the photosynthesis reaction is used by the plant to fuel respiration and is turned into carbon dioxide, water, and energy.</em>

<h3><u>Explanation;</u></h3>
  • <em><u>Photosynthesis</u></em> is the process by which green plants make their own food, by using energy from <em><u>the sun, carbon dioxide and water to produce simple sugars. </u></em>
  • The equation for the reaction is; 6 CO2 + 6 H2O → C6H12O6 + 6 O2
  • <em><u>During cellular respiration the products of photosynthesis (C6H1206)  and O2 </u></em>are used together to generate energy in the form of ATP and carbon dioxide, together with water as by products.
  • Thus, it means <em><u>the products of photosynthesis are the reactants of cellular respiration and the products of cellular respiration are the reactants of photosynthesis.</u></em>
